The French service BlaBlaCar is coming to our market, which is the European leader in carpooling. In addition, BlaBlaCar is definitely not starting from scratch in the Czech Republic. The entry into the market took place through the acquisition of the previous Czech number one, the website Jizdomat.cz. The fusion of the two services has already fully manifested itself, and from today it is not possible to offer or request carpools through Jízdomat. BlaBlaCar, on the other hand, is already fully operational.

Users of Jízdomat must create a new account and download a new application, but the positive thing is that from Jízdomat, planned trips and all ratings can be transferred to BlaBlaCar. Drivers and passengers will therefore not lose their already acquired reputation, even if their manual intervention is required, as a result, they can smoothly continue carpooling without major hiccups.

Since its inception in 2010, Jízdomat has already offered 4,5 million free spaces in users' cars, while hundreds of thousands of these spaces have been filled thanks to the service. However, the company never made much profit and it was more of a charity project. The motive behind the acquisition by the French giant is mainly to profit from an already functioning community and "liquidate" the competition, which would be difficult to fight, at least at the beginning.

However, BlaBlaCar is not a small-scale charity, but a pure business of global proportions. The French company, whose value is set at $1,5 billion, brokered over 10 million rides in 22 countries in the last quarter alone. He earns by taking a commission from the paid fare, which is usually set at around 10%. However, Czechs do not have to worry about such fees yet.

BlaBlaCar enters new markets through similar acquisitions quite regularly and always operates for free at least for some time. As Pavel Prouza, head of the Czechoslovak branch of BlaBlaCar, confirmed, the same will be the case in the Czech Republic and Slovakia. "We are not planning to introduce commissions yet," he said Server idle iDnes.

As for the prices of individual journeys, BlaBlaCar sets a recommended price for the route for drivers, which is calculated at 80 pennies per kilometer. The driver can then manipulate the price up and down by up to 50 percent. It may then happen that you also come across a more expensive fare, which is due to the fact that the recommended price is always calculated according to the conditions in the driver's country. So if you go with a foreigner who is just passing through the Czech Republic, the ride will probably be more expensive.
